A fatal accident on Route 55 involving at least two vehicles closed down a section of Route 55 to start Friday morning's commute.

New Jersey State Police spokesman Sgt, Gregory Williams said a car went off the ramp from the southbound 42 Freeway onto southbound Route 55 and hit a tree. The driver got out of the car to assess the damage and was struck and killed by a second vehicle around 5:40 a.m.

Williams said mid-Friday morning the accident investigation unit was on location and has not determined if the rain played a role in the accident.

The ramp from the 42 Freeway remained closed as of 8 a.m., causing a multi-mile delay that started at Interstate 295.

"If you stick with 42 for just one more exit you can get off at Clements Bridge Road and head towards the Deptford Mall. Take a left onto Almonesson Road and that will get you back on Route 55," said Townsquare Media's Jill Myra.
